Q: Is 230,978 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 230,978 is a composite number.

Why is 230,978 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 230,978 can be evenly divided by 1 2 11 22 10,499 20,998 115,489 and 230,978, with no remainder.

Since 230,978 cannot be divided by just 1 and 230,978, it is a composite number.
